look up any word, like demisexual:

2 definitions by Paul Niklas

someone that's new to something and is bad at it
Josh your such a newb at cricket.
by Paul Niklas December 21, 2006
up the ass and in the mouth
I just had a spit roast Johnnie, Very yummy suzanna.
by Paul Niklas May 04, 2007